Comport K's single-game record 14 to highlight sweep of Cazenovia

SYRACUSE, N.Y. - Tyler Comport struck out a single-game program best 14 batters in six innings of work in game two that highlighted the Penn State Berks baseball teams sweep of Cazenovia College on Saturday afternoon. The Nittany Lions picked up a 6-1 win in the first game behind another pitching gem by Dylan Gallagher and went on to win the nightcap by a 15-2 margin.

The Nittany Lions moved back to .500 for the first time this season as they improve to 16-16 overall and 9-3 in the NEAC, while the Wildcats drop to 4-22 on the year and 3-10 in the conference.

In the opener, Gallagher tossed all seven innings with a three-hitter to earn his second straight complete-game victory on the hill. The senior right-hander struck out three batters and issued just one walk for the game. The lone run scored off of Gallagher came in the bottom of the fourth with a fly ball to center field to score the runner from third tagging up.

Cory Fox went 3-for-3 with a double and triple to pace the offense. In the top of the third, Fox tripled to center field to score TROY SALERNO and then came in to score on a wild pitch. Toby Welk roped a triple to right center in the fifth that scored Fox and
Dalton Hughes. Zach Reis finished off the scoring for Berks with a single up the middle that again plated Fox and Hughes.

In the second game, Comport dominated right out of the gate with a strikeout of all three batters in order in the first inning. He fanned the side in three innings and struck out two batters in two other innings. He surpassed the previous school record of 12 strikeouts by striking out the side in the sixth inning after allowing a leadoff double.

Cody Fidler added one strikeout in relief and Jon Davis recorded a pair of strikeouts in the ninth as the trio combined on a team record 17 total punchouts.

At the plate, Fox was 3-for-5 with an RBI and four runs scored, while Hughes finished 3-for-5 with an RBI and two runs scored. Welk added another triple and went 2-for-4 with four runs batted in and one run scored. Mitch Amenta was 2-for-5 with three RBI and Brandon Griesemer added two hits and scored three runs.
